1. Check the Course Curriculum and Topics Covered

The first step in choosing an HR Payroll Course is reviewing the syllabus. A good payroll course should cover all important aspects of payroll management, from basic concepts to advanced processes.

Look for courses that include topics such as:

  • Payroll fundamentals
  • Salary structure and calculations
  • Employee data management
  • Attendance and leave management
  • Payroll processing
  • Payslip generation
  • Statutory compliance
  • Payroll reporting

A comprehensive curriculum ensures that you gain complete knowledge of payroll operations instead of learning only theoretical concepts.

4. Consider Industry-Relevant Compliance Training

Payroll professionals must ensure that salary processing follows government regulations and company policies. Compliance knowledge is one of the most valuable skills employers look for in payroll candidates.

A good HR Payroll Course should cover important compliance areas, including:

  • Provident Fund (PF)
  • Employee State Insurance (ESI)
  • Professional Tax
  • Income Tax calculations
  • Labour law basics

Understanding compliance helps professionals avoid payroll errors and support organizations in maintaining accurate records.
